Notes

  • It is recommended that students complete the required FCS 398a01 (2-3 credit hours) Professonal Practice in the summer following the third year.
  • To graduate in this sequence, a student must take at least one course for graduate credit during the senior year. Up to 12 hours of approved graduate courses may be taken that will count for both the undergraduate and graduate program. The student must consult with an advisor and the instructor prior to the start of each new course to ensure approval. Students can then apply to the Family and Consumer Sciences graduate program in the spring of their senior year.
